As a Product Manager you will assist with managing complex technology platforms throughout their product life cycle and help define the landscape and roadmap. This job is part of the Product Management job function. Together with your Product colleagues you will be responsible for the planning, design, and implementation of products and product extensions during all life cycle stages.

What You’ll Do:
  • Build relationships with key users and stakeholders to better understand their business and decompose them into user stories.
  • Assist in the development of advanced products and projects by writing use cases and high-level requirements for internal teams.
  • Assist with the management of technology products through the entire product development life cycle.
  • Support in the refinement and prioritizing of product backlog while working in collaboration with a line of business partners and a scrum team. Ensure features, stories, and tasks are well understood and supported.
  • Troubleshoot and escalate product issues and client requests. Serve as backup to the principal Product Managers.
  • Contribute to training and education in subject matter areas including demos and supporting release notes.
  • Work with the stakeholders to identify and plan for dependencies, fill product gaps, and research opportunities.
  • Apply general knowledge of standard principles and techniques/procedures to accomplish assigned tasks and solve routine problems.
  • Have a broad knowledge of own job discipline and some knowledge of several job disciplines within the function.
  • Lead by example and model behaviors that are consistent with CBRE RISE values. May convince to reach an agreement.
  • Impact the quality of own work and the work of others on the team.
  • Work primarily within standardized procedures and practices to achieve objectives and meet deadlines.
  • Explain complex information to others in straightforward situations.

What You’ll Need:
  • Bachelor's Degree preferred with a minimum of 2 years of relevant experience. 
  • Our ideal candidate has prior Product Management experience within the investment management, finance, or real estate industries.
  • Understanding of existing procedures and standards to solve slightly complex problems.
  • Ability to analyze possible solutions using technical experience to apply appropriate judgment and precedents.
  • In-depth knowledge of Microsoft Office products. Examples include Word, Excel, Outlook, etc.
  • Experience with Product Management tools such as JIRA or Azure Dev Ops.
  • Familiarity with data & data analysis; experience in languages such as SQL, Python, or R is preferred.
  • Strong organizational skills with an inquisitive mindset.
